Eric Fasking & Associates, insurance staff counsel for State Farm Insurance Companies, is seeking a Legal Administrative Support team member to join the Jacksonville, FL Claim Litigation office. This is an excellent entry level opportunity on our Administrative Mail & File team for individuals seeking to gain legal experience with a focus on growth and development. While every day can provide different experiences and opportunities, a typical day involves providing administrative assistance to Law Department colleagues including attorneys and leadership in a fast-paced civil litigation environment. Responsibilities will include, but are not limited to, reception area duties, scanning high volumes of incoming mail, processing incoming and outgoing mail, updating case management software, providing clerical support, and other administrative duties as assigned. The office allows for collaborative environments with access to team members for support. This position is classified as an in-office essential role, meaning that the work arrangement calls for daily hours to be completed in the office. Work arrangements could change over time based on business needs. Hours for the position are Monday-Friday, 8:30 am – 5:00 pm.
